Transaction afeacde30cea5c690e5a3d0465b549fb7b5d58a0d17ccebbc589477ef35fbf89

2 Input
2 Outputs
  • afeacde30cea5c690e5a3d0465b549fb7b5d58a0d17ccebbc589477ef35fbf89:0
  • value  312833
    address  3BTcLm9BXRJAKvAZPhFH4zpG86KqAkJPsq
  • afeacde30cea5c690e5a3d0465b549fb7b5d58a0d17ccebbc589477ef35fbf89:1
  • value  752
    address  bc1q4wm4qx4vr5w6g8nudks2fp9hummyqpa4tfpq2y